This dissertation proposes that childhood growth can also reflect inequality in the distribution of psychosocial stress exposure through mothers’ feelings of a chronically stressful environment conveyed through maternal-infant interactions.

Detection Of Local Steroidogenic Enzyme Gene Expression In Brown Anoles, Ada Spahija Jan 2018

Detection Of Local Steroidogenic Enzyme Gene Expression In Brown Anoles, Ada Spahija

Honors Program Theses

The endocrine system in vertebrates responds to stress by releasing steroid hormones, mainly glucocorticoids (GC), which increase blood glucose levels to supply key organs and muscles with energy needed for survival. Steroid hormones are synthesized via an enzymatic pathway that converts cholesterol into either GCs, androgens, or estrogens in a step-wise manner. The adrenal cortex is known to produce GCs, but evidence suggests that individual organs can also produce steroid hormones de novo in response to stress. Endocrine Responses To Repeated Adrenocorticotropic Hormone Administration In Free-Ranging Elephant, Molly Mccormley Jan 2018

Endocrine Responses To Repeated Adrenocorticotropic Hormone Administration In Free-Ranging Elephant, Molly Mccormley

University of the Pacific Theses and Dissertations

Understanding the physiological response of marine mammals to anthropogenic stressors can inform marine ecosystem conservation strategies. Stress stimulates release of glucocorticoid (GC) hormones, which increase energy substrate availability while suppressing energy-intensive processes. Exposure to repeated stressors can potentially affect an animal’s ability to respond to and recover from subsequent challenges. To assess the endocrine response of a marine mammal to repeated stressors, we administered adrenocorticotropic hormone (ACTH) to free-ranging juvenile northern elephant seals (Mirounga angustirostris; n=7) once daily for four days. ACTH administration induced significant, but transient (<24 h) elevation in circulating cortisol levels (p < 0.0001). These increases did not vary in magnitude between the first ACTH challenge on day 1 and the last challenge on day 4. In contrast, aldosterone levels remained elevated above baseline for at least 24 hours after each ACTH injection (p < 0.001), and responses were greater on day 4 than day 1 (p < 0.01). Total triiodothyronine (tT3) levels were decreased on day 4 relative to day 1 (p < 0.01), while reverse triiodothyronine (rT3) concentrations increased relative to baseline on days 1 and 4 (p < 0.001) in response to ACTH, indicating a suppression of thyroid hormone secretion. There was no effect of ACTH on the sex steroid dehydroepiandrosterone (DHEA). These results suggest that elephant seals are able to mount adrenal responses to multiple ACTH challenges. However, repeated stress results in facilitation of aldosterone secretion and suppression of tT3, which may impact osmoregulation and metabolism. We propose that aldosterone and tT3 are informative additional indicators of repeated stress in marine mammals.
